Doctors are using pharmacogenomics to help determine what drugs will work, and which drugs to avoid.

not new, but more and more doctors are testing their patients to see how they process a variety of drugs from pain relievers to cardio medications.  This will tell them who the medication will work for, who it won’t, and who might have a severe drug reaction and avoid that.

Doctors keep the genetic information on file so they can check to see if a drug will work or cause a problem before prescribing it.  This helps take the guesswork out of prescriptions.

Pharmacogenomics not only helps with medications patients are currently taking, but will guide their future prescriptions and potentially save lives.
